Write the struucture of eye lens and state the role of ciliary muscles in the human eye.
Text Solution
Verified by Experts
The eye lens is a transparent biconvex structure in the eye. The ciliary muscles hold the crystalline lens to provide the finer adjustment of focal length required to focus objects at different distances on the retina by relaxing and contracting themselves.
